Fits:
LHD (Left Hand drive) cars
Porsche 9YA Cayenne 2018 - 2024
* for vehicles without rear axle steering (option code: 0N1)
Diagram ref no 1
• OE ref part numbers: PAB423055, PAB423055C, PAB423055F, PAB423055G
• Location: Front steering system—rack & pinion/steering gear assembly mounted beneath the front sub-frame, linking to tie-rods and steering column.

What Do Steering Racks Do?
The steering rack converts the rotational motion of the steering wheel into linear movement, controlling the vehicle’s front wheels for directional accuracy.
Core Functions:
• Transfer steering input into smooth, precise wheel movement.
• Work in conjunction with the power steering system for ease of control.
• Maintain correct wheel alignment and tracking.
• Provide balanced feedback and road feel.
• Ensure stability and steering accuracy at all speeds.
A properly functioning steering rack delivers confidence-inspiring handling — from high-speed motorway cruising to tight cornering on track.
Why Do Steering Racks Fail or Degrade?
Steering racks experience constant pressure, movement, and exposure to heat and contaminants, leading to gradual wear over time.
Common Causes of Failure Include:
• Seal wear leading to hydraulic fluid leaks.
• Corrosion or pitting on internal rack surfaces.
• Play or looseness in steering due to worn bushings or joints.
• Power steering fluid contamination causing internal damage.
• Age-related degradation in gaskets or mounts.
When steering racks begin to fail, symptoms include excessive play, vibration, fluid leaks, uneven steering effort, or knocking noises — all signs that replacement or refurbishment is required.
